The Impact of UV on Outdoor Rubber Hoses and Preventive Measures
2025-03-27
Ultraviolet rays have a significant and adverse effect on rubber hoses that are exposed to the outdoors for extended periods. Implementing appropriate UV protection measures is crucial for extending the lifespan of rubber hoses.
The Impact of Ultraviolet Radiation on Rubber Hoses
Molecular Chain Breakdown:
Ultraviolet radiation possesses high energy, which can directly damage the rubber molecular chains, leading to chain断裂 and cross-linking, thereby affecting the physical and mechanical properties of rubber hoses.
Surface Aging:
Prolonged exposure to UV radiation can lead to aging of rubber hoses, manifesting in hardening, stickiness, and discoloration. These changes can degrade the hoses' performance and aesthetic appeal.
Accelerated Oxidation:
Rubber hoses produce free radicals after absorbing light energy, which then trigger and accelerate the oxidation chain reaction process, leading to the gradual degradation and failure of the hose material.
Two: UV Protection Methods for Rubber Hoses
Add Antioxidant:
During the production of rubber hoses, additives like polyarylamides, epoxides, or phosphates can be incorporated as antioxidants. These antioxidants significantly enhance the rubber's anti-oxidative and anti-ultraviolet capabilities, thereby effectively slowing down the aging process.
Implement Nested Protection:
Rubber hoses are encapsulated within protective layers made of materials such as polyethylene, polypropylene, or polyamide, which offer UV-resistant coatings. These materials act as an additional protective barrier for the hoses, shielding them from harmful UV rays.
Utilize shading facilities:
When in use outdoors, set up sunshades, awnings, and other sun-blocking devices to prevent the rubber hose from being directly exposed to ultraviolet rays for extended periods.
Dark installation processing:
For outdoor rubber hoses, consider burying them underground or inside walls to minimize direct sunlight exposure.
Coating with UV-resistant paint:
Coating the surface of rubber hoses with an anti-ultraviolet paint creates a protective layer that effectively blocks UV damage. This coating should have excellent adhesion and weather resistance to ensure long-lasting protection.
Regular Inspections and Maintenance:
Regular inspections and maintenance of rubber hoses can help detect and address issues like aging and wear early on, extending their lifespan and reducing damage caused by UV radiation.
Ultraviolet rays have a significant adverse effect on rubber hoses exposed to the outdoors for extended periods. However, by adding anti-aging agents, implementing nested protection, using shading facilities, darkening treatments, applying UV-resistant coatings, and conducting regular inspections and maintenance, the impact of UV rays on rubber hoses can be effectively reduced, extending their lifespan and maintaining their excellent performance.
